[. . . ] EPSON PowerLite 735c Multimedia Projector ® ® User's Guide Important Safety Information WARNING: Never look into the projector lens when the lamp is turned on; the bright light can damage your eyes. Never let children look into the lens when it is on. Never open any cover on the projector, except the lamp and filter covers. Dangerous electrical voltages inside the projector can severely injure you. Be sure to use the transfer process described below to ensure that the scenario plays properly: 1. From the Scenario Option menu, choose Send Scenario. You see a drive selection window: note You have to save the scenario on your computer's hard drive before transferring it. Don't use Windows to copy the scenario to your memory card, or it may not play properly. Select your memory card drive 2. Choose the drive where your card is located, then click OK. Your scenario is transferred to the card. Once the scenario is transferred, you see this message about your scenario's autorun setting: The autorun setting means that the scenario will start playing whenever the projector is turned on (with the memory card in the projector). Do one of the following: If you don't want the scenario to run automatically, click Cancel. Skip to step 8 to remove the card and insert it in the projector. If you want it to run automatically, click OK and continue with the following instructions. Presenting from a Memory Card 63 You see the Edit Autorun window: Scenarios on the card Scenario set to run automatically note If more than one scenario is set to run automatically, they will play in the order listed on this screen. 5. To set a scenario to run automatically, select it from the list on the left side of the screen and use the arrow button to move it to the list on the right. Click the Revive box if you want your scenario to repeat continuously. Clear the checkbox if you want it to play only once. See your computer's documentation if you need instructions on removing the card. If you're using Windows 2000 or Me, you may first need to click an icon to stop or disconnect the card. 64 Presenting from a Memory Card Inserting the Memory Card in the Projector When done transferring your scenario to the memory card, follow these steps to insert it in the projector: 1. If necessary, insert the card into a PC card adapter. (ATA flash cards don't require an adapter. ) 2. Insert the card (with the adapter) into the projector as shown. The projector does not have to be turned off before inserting the card. Presenting from a Memory Card 65 Removing the Card When you're done using the projector and want to remove the memory card, follow these steps. Make sure a scenario is not playing and the card is not in use (the access light next to the card slot is off) before removing it. Press the button next to the card slot. Push button to remove card The button pops out. [. . . ] EPSON will, at its option, repair or replace on an exchange basis the defective unit, without charge for parts or labor. When warranty service involves the exchange of the product or of a part, the item replaced becomes EPSON property. The exchanged product or part may be new or previously repaired to the EPSON standard of quality. Exchange or replacement products or parts assume the remaining warranty period of the product covered by this limited warranty. [. . . ]
